Pakistan Cables Treasury Stock Calculation

The portion of shares that a company keeps in their own treasury. Treasury stock may have come from a repurchase or buyback from shareholders; or it may have never been issued to the public in the first place. These shares don't pay dividends, have no voting rights, and should not be included in shares outstanding calculations.

Pakistan Cables Business Description

Address 23, M.T. Khan Road, 1st Floor, Arif Habib Center, Karachi, SD, PAK, 75700
Pakistan Cables Ltd is an electronic components manufacturer. It is engaged in the business of copper rods, wires, cables, and conductors, aluminium extrusion profiles, wiring accessories, and PVC compounds.
